  • location   State Hiway NM 9, mm 92.5, 0.3 mile east of road south to VOR station, 4.2 miles east of junction with NM 11 in Columbus, (Luna County, New Mexico, US)
  • family Poaceae
  • plant community   Chihuahuan Desert Tobosa-Alkali Sacation playa grassland at 4006' (1221m )
  • notes   Perennial grass in largely overgrazed playa grassland on silty clay flats of the extensive Mimbres playa, with Atriplex acanthocarpa, Sporobolis airoides, Gutierrezia, Tidestromia and Prosopis glandulosa. SYN: Pleuraphis m.
